Select*fromtesting;+--------- ---- +---------------------+|Nama Pelajar|Tarikhreg |+-------------+--- --- --------------+|Ram &"/> Select*fromtesting;+--------- ---- +---------------------+|Nama Pelajar|Tarikhreg |+-------------+--- --- --------------+|Ram &">

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k menggunakan fungsi EXTRACT() pada tarikh yang disimpan dalam jadual MySQL?

Bagaimana untuk menggunakan fungsi EXTRACT() pada tarikh yang disimpan dalam jadual MySQL?

PHPz
PHPzke hadapan
2023-08-23 18:25:02543semak imbas

如何对 MySQL 表中存储的日期应用 EXTRACT() 函数?

Kita boleh menggunakan fungsi EXTRACT() pada tarikh yang disimpan dalam jadual MySQL dengan -

Pertanyaan berikut menunjukkan tarikh yang dimasukkan dalam jadual "testing"

mysql> Select * from testing;
+-------------+---------------------+
| StudentName | Dateofreg           |
+-------------+---------------------+
| Ram         | 2017-10-28 21:24:24 |
| Shyam       | 2017-10-28 21:24:30 |
| Mohan       | 2017-10-28 21:24:47 |
| Gaurav      | 2017-10-29 08:48:33 |
+-------------+---------------------+
4 rows in set (0.00 sec)

Sekarang, kita boleh memohon pada "testing" fungsi table EXTRACT() untuk mendapatkan nilai tahun, seperti berikut-

mysql> Select EXTRACT(Year from dateofreg)AS YEAR from testing;
+------+
| YEAR |
+------+
| 2017 |
| 2017 |
| 2017 |
| 2017 |
+------+
4 rows in set (0.00 sec)

Begitu juga, kita boleh menggunakan fungsi EXTRACT() pada jadual "testing" untuk mendapatkan nilai tarikh, seperti berikut-

mysql> Select EXTRACT(day from dateofreg)AS DAY from testing;
+-----+
| DAY |
+-----+
| 28  |
| 28  |
| 28  |
| 29  |
+-----+
4 rows in set (0.00 sec)

Atas ialah kandungan terperinci Bagaimana untuk menggunakan fungsi EXTRACT() pada tarikh yang disimpan dalam jadual M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Artikel ini dikembalikan pada:tutorialspoint.com. Jika ada pelanggaran, sila hubungi admin@php.cn Padam